How they compare
Philippines currently reports 2.7% against 2.5% in Mexico, a difference of 0.2%.
That makes Philippines's figure about 1.1 times Mexico's.
Across all 12 years both countries report, Philippines has been ahead every year.
Mexico ranks 45th and Philippines ranks 42nd of 122 countries.
Philippines has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
